MEMORANDUM

Posted: January 13, 2020 04:18 PM
From: Senator Joe Pittman
To: All Senate members
Subject: Expansion of Property Tax Exemption for 100% Disabled Veterans
 

In the near future, I plan to introduce legislation to address shortcomings to the 100% disabled veteran’s property tax exemption. The purpose of this legislation is twofold.

First, it will address the issue of many 100% disabled veterans who are ineligible for property tax exemption because of the way their income is calculated. These veterans—some of whom have the greatest need for property tax exemption—receive disability benefits designed to assist them in paying for everyday functioning, caregiving, medication management and renovations to their residence to accommodate their disability. Under current statute, these benefits are calculated as part of a disabled veteran’s income to determine eligibility for property tax exemption. This legislation will exclude federal veteran’s disability benefits from the calculation of “income.”

Second, this bill will eliminate the wartime service requirement for property tax exemption. Regardless of when they served, those who have become 100% disabled due to their military service have made a great sacrifice and are deserving of this benefit.

Please join me in honoring those who have sacrificed so much through their service of this great Nation and our Commonwealth.



Introduced as SB1265
